Finding a Used Airbag: What You Need to Know

Acquiring a used airbag can seem attractive, especially given the high cost of new ones. However, it's absolutely vital to understand Used Airbag Parts the inherent dangers before you even start this path. Airbags are safety-critical components designed for a single impact and their integrity is paramount; re-using them after an accident, regardless of apparent condition, can severely compromise your protection in a subsequent collision. Many factors – including the airbag’s history, potential internal damage that's not evident , and manufacturing variations across different models - make it extraordinarily difficult to guarantee reliability. It is strongly advised to always opt for a new airbag from a reputable supplier like have your vehicle inspected by a qualified mechanic.

Replacement Airbags: Savings and Considerations

Considering substitute airbags can be a significant way to reduce vehicle repair charges after an accident, but it's crucial to weigh the benefits against certain factors . While aftermarket or salvaged airbags are often more affordable than original equipment manufacturer (OEM) units, they may not meet the same stringent safety standards.

  • Potential Savings: Often, aftermarket options can provide a considerable price cut.
  • Safety Concerns: Always investigate the supplier's history and ensure the airbag has been properly inspected .
  • Warranty Implications: Using a non-OEM airbag might impact your vehicle's warranty – it's wise to check with your dealer .
  • Installation Complexity: Airbag installation can be complex; professional assistance from a qualified technician is always recommended for safety and proper functionality.

Ultimately, the decision to pursue a replacement airbag copyrights on balancing cost savings with potential compromises in quality and long-term vehicle reliability.
